Bruins Put Up a Strong Fight Against No. 11 Sagehens in Second Round of NCAA Tournament

CLAREMONT, Cal. -- The George Fox women's lacrosse team lost their final game of the season in the NCAA Tournament's second round against Pomiona-Pitzer, 19-7. The Bruins jumped out to a big 5-1 lead to end the first quarter.

The Bruins started out on the front foot when they finished the first period with five goal. Morgan Maxfield scored her first goal just five minutes into the game. Maxfield scored again only a minute later while the Sagehens fell behind. Fox jumped out to a three goal lead after Marena Tharpe scored with 8:35 minutes left. The Sagehens scored their first goal of the game halfway through the quarter. Carleigh DeLapp scored the next goal for the Bruins to push them back to a three-goal lead. Tharpe scored her second with 4:30 minutes left in the first period, extending the lead, 5-1.

The second period wasn't a hot one for the Bruins. Pomona-Pitzer their second and third goals right off the bat in the second period, but Fox worked to stay ahead when Ava Bluhm scored the sixth goal of the game. That's when the Bruins started to lose steam as the Sagehens made their way in front with seven straigh goals, ending the second period up 10-6.

Pomona-Pitzer scored their next goal just about five minutes into the second half. The Bruins pushed to try to catch up in the start of the second quarter. Lana Davis scored a stunning goal with 6:01  left of the game, but the Sagehens scored two more goals, putting them even more in the lead 13-7 to end the third.

Unfortunately, all that the fourth quarter had in store for the Bruins were six more goals scored by Sagehens. George Fox left the game with a 19-7 loss for their final game of the season.

Top Performers
Morgan Maxfield and Marena Tharpe scored two strong goals each in the first quarter, while Lana Davis, Carleigh DeLapp, and Ava Bluhm scored one goal each. Emma Webb had fifteen impressive saves.
